Selecting Machine Devices: A Purchaser's Guide

When purchasing an vision device, many considerations must thorough evaluation . Resolution , capture frequency, sensor type, and connection type – like GigE Vision, USB3 Vision, or CoaXPress – are vital elements . Additionally , evaluate the functional conditions , such as climate, illumination , and any likely motion. Finally, cost and long-term requirements should always inform your selection.

Factory Cameras for Sale : Features & Considerations

Finding the appropriate industrial camera for your particular application requires thorough evaluation . These heavy-duty cameras are designed to handle harsh conditions , often including high vibration , extreme cold, and powerful lighting . Key features to consider include sensor dimension , clarity , frame frequency, and optics type. Think about factors such as communication options (e.g., GigE, USB3, Camera Link), energy consumption, and operational classification (IP67, IP68) to ensure suitability with your setup .
